3. The other big deal is that I finally finished the reworking of Ultramix 90 and there’s a new webpage for it here (the other mixes will use that design soon too). The new version of this mix I first did just over five years ago is to commemorate the 20th anniversary of the tracks featured. It’s split into five parts all just under an hour long and includes redone bits, a re-arranged order, extra tracks and some lovely new combos and segues. Very pleased with it to the point where I don’t expect to be messing about with it ever again.
